.NET框架,全称是.NET Framework,是微软公司开发的一个用于构建、部署和管理应用的平台。它为开发人员提供了一个统一的编程模型,无论你是开发桌面应用、Web应用还是移动应用,.NET框架都能提供强大的支持。对于Windows客户端开发者来说,掌握.NET框架是迈向高效编程的第一步。下面,就让我带你轻松上手.NET框架,告别编程难题!
一、.NET框架简介
.NET框架的核心是一个称为公共语言运行时(CLR)的执行环境。CLR负责执行.NET代码,确保代码的安全性和一致性。.NET框架提供了丰富的类库,包括字符串处理、文件操作、网络通信等,大大简化了开发过程。
1.1 CLR
公共语言运行时(CLR)是.NET框架的核心组件,它负责执行.NET代码。CLR具有以下特点:
- 跨语言兼容性:不同编程语言编写的代码可以在CLR上无缝运行。
- 内存管理:CLR自动管理内存,减少内存泄漏的风险。
- 异常处理:CLR提供强大的异常处理机制,帮助开发者更好地控制程序运行。
1.2 类库
.NET框架提供了丰富的类库,包括:
- System:包含基本数据类型、集合、字符串处理等。
- System.IO:提供文件和目录操作。
- System.Net:提供网络通信功能。
- System.Windows.Forms:提供桌面应用开发组件。
二、安装.NET框架
在Windows客户端上安装.NET框架非常简单。以下以Windows 10为例:
- 打开“控制面板”。
- 点击“程序”。
- 选择“打开或关闭Windows功能”。
- 在列表中找到“.NET Framework 3.5或更高版本”。
- 点击“打开或关闭Windows功能”旁边的复选框,勾选它。
- 点击“确定”开始安装。
三、开发环境
为了开发.NET应用,你需要安装以下开发环境:
3.1 Visual Studio
Visual Studio是微软提供的集成开发环境(IDE),它支持多种编程语言,包括C#、VB.NET、F#等。以下是安装Visual Studio的步骤:
- 访问Visual Studio官方网站。
- 选择合适的版本和安装选项。
- 下载安装程序。
- 运行安装程序并按照提示进行安装。
3.2 .NET SDK
.NET SDK是.NET开发的核心组件,它包含编译器、工具和库。以下是安装.NET SDK的步骤:
- 打开命令提示符。
- 输入以下命令:
dotnet --info - 检查.NET SDK版本是否安装正确。
- 如果未安装,请访问.NET官方网站下载并安装。
四、编写第一个.NET应用
以下是一个简单的C#控制台应用示例,用于输出“Hello, World!”:
using System;
namespace HelloWorld
{
class Program
{
static void Main(string[] args)
{
Console.WriteLine("Hello, World!");
}
}
}
- 打开Visual Studio。
- 创建一个名为“HelloWorld”的新项目。
- 将上述代码复制到“Program.cs”文件中。
- 点击“启动”按钮,运行程序。
恭喜你,你已经成功编写并运行了第一个.NET应用!
五、总结
通过本文的介绍,相信你已经对.NET框架有了初步的了解。掌握.NET框架,将为你的编程之路带来更多可能性。在接下来的学习中,你可以尝试开发更多有趣的应用,不断提升自己的编程技能。祝你在.NET框架的世界里,探索出一片属于自己的天地!
